Why A-Line Dresses Are a Wardrobe Essential for Women

A-line dresses for women have stood the test of time as a versatile, universally flattering wardrobe staple. Characterized by a fitted bodice that gently flares from the waist to the hem (resembling the letter “A”), this silhouette complements nearly every body type, occasion, and personal style. Whether you’re dressing for a wedding, office meeting, date night, or casual brunch, an A-line dress balances comfort and elegance effortlessly. Unlike restrictive styles or trend-driven designs that fade quickly, A-line dresses for women offer timeless appeal—making them a smart investment for any closet. What Makes A-Line Dresses for Women Universally Flattering?

The magic of A-line dresses for women lies in their ability to enhance and balance the body’s natural shape. Here’s why they work for everyone:

  • Waist Definition: The fitted bodice and flared skirt create a clear waistline, even for those with a straighter figure. This cinched effect accentuates curves and creates an hourglass illusion.
  • Hip & Thigh Coverage: The gradual flare skims over hips, thighs, and lower belly, camouflaging any areas you want to soften while maintaining a feminine silhouette.
  • Length Versatility: A-line dresses for women come in mini, midi, and maxi lengths—each adapting to different heights and occasions. Petites thrive in midi or mini A-lines (avoid overwhelming maxis), while taller women can rock floor-length styles with ease.
  • Proportion Harmony: For pear-shaped bodies, the flared skirt balances wider hips with a narrower upper body. For apple-shaped figures, it draws attention away from the midsection to the legs. Hourglass and athletic bodies benefit from the silhouette’s ability to highlight curves without clinging.

How to Choose the Perfect A-Line Dress for Women: Key Factors

1. Body Type Tailoring

While A-line dresses are universally flattering, small adjustments can make them even more personalized:

  • Pear-Shaped: Opt for A-line dresses with embellished or ruffled bodices (to draw attention upward) and structured fabrics (like cotton or linen) that hold their shape. Avoid overly flowy skirts that add volume to hips.
  • Apple-Shaped: Choose A-line dresses with a V-neck or square neckline (to elongate the torso) and an empire waist (slightly above the natural waist) for a looser midsection fit.
  • Hourglass: Select fitted A-line dresses with a defined waistband and stretchy fabrics (jersey, satin) that hug your curves without constricting.
  • Athletic: Look for A-line dresses with puffed sleeves, lace overlays, or belted waists to add softness and create the illusion of curves.
  • Petite: Stick to midi or mini A-line dresses with vertical prints or subtle slits to lengthen the legs. Avoid wide, voluminous skirts that can overwhelm your frame.
  • Plus-Size: Choose A-line dresses for women with supportive bodices, stretchy fabrics, and a flare that starts at the natural waist (not too high or low) for balanced proportions. Brands like Torrid, Eloquii, and ASOS Curve excel in inclusive sizing.

2. Fabric & Occasion

A-line dresses for women come in fabrics that suit every event—from casual to formal:

  • Casual Occasions (Brunches, Errands, Picnics): Linen, cotton, or chambray A-line dresses. Opt for short or midi lengths, playful prints (stripes, florals), or solid neutral tones. Pair with sneakers or sandals for a relaxed vibe.
  • Office/Professional Settings: Tailored A-line dresses in crepe, wool-blend, or ponte knit. Choose knee-length or midi styles in black, navy, gray, or subtle prints. Add a blazer and pumps for a polished look.
  • Semi-Formal Events (Weddings, Cocktail Parties): Satin, lace, or tulle A-line dresses. Midi or maxi lengths with delicate embellishments (beading, embroidery) work beautifully. Pair with strappy heels and statement jewelry.
  • Formal Galas/Proms: Luxe fabrics like silk, velvet, or sequined A-line dresses. Floor-length styles with illusion necklines or sheer sleeves add glamour. Opt for bold colors (emerald, ruby, gold) or classic black.

3. Neckline & Sleeve Options

The neckline and sleeves of an A-line dress can transform its vibe:

  • Necklines: V-neck (elongates the neck), square neck (retro-chic), sweetheart (romantic), boat neck (elegant), or crew neck (casual). Choose based on your comfort level and occasion.
  • Sleeves: Sleeveless (summer-friendly), cap sleeves (modest), short sleeves (casual), long sleeves (winter or formal), or puff sleeves (trendy and feminine). For broader shoulders, avoid overly padded sleeves; opt for delicate cap sleeves instead.

Top Styling Tips for A-Line Dresses for Women

An A-line dress is incredibly versatile—here’s how to style it for any look:

  • Shoes: Heels (pumps, strappy sandals, block heels) elevate A-line dresses for formal events. For casual outings, pair with white sneakers, ankle boots, or espadrilles. Petites can opt for nude heels to lengthen legs.
  • Accessories: Belts (thin or wide) accentuate the waist further—great for looser A-line dresses. Statement earrings or a dainty necklace complement simple bodices. Clutches or crossbody bags work for parties, while tote bags suit casual days.
  • Layers: Add a denim jacket, leather moto jacket, or cropped blazer for edge. For cooler weather, throw on a trench coat or cardigan. A shawl or pashmina complements formal A-line dresses for weddings or galas.
  • Hair & Makeup: Updos (buns, ponytails) highlight the neckline and waist of A-line dresses. Soft waves or loose curls add romance. For makeup, keep it natural for casual events (tinted moisturizer, mascara, lip balm) or bold for formal occasions (smoky eyes, red lips).

2024 Trends for A-Line Dresses for Women

While A-line dresses are timeless, these 2024 trends add a modern twist:

  • Bold Prints: Floral maxi A-line dresses, animal prints (leopard, zebra), and geometric patterns are dominating. Opt for large-scale prints for making a statement or dainty prints for subtlety.
  • Sheer Details: Sheer sleeves, lace overlays, or illusion necklines add romance and sophistication to A-line dresses—perfect for weddings or date nights.
  • Sustainable Fabrics: Eco-friendly A-line dresses made from organic cotton, linen, or recycled polyester are on the rise. Brands like Reformation, Patagonia, and Everlane offer stylish, sustainable options.
  • Bright Colors: Vibrant hues like coral, electric blue, and sunflower yellow are popular for spring/summer. For fall/winter, deep burgundy, forest green, and burnt orange take center stage.
  • Asymmetrical Hemlines: A-line dresses with uneven hemlines (shorter in front, longer in back) add a playful, modern touch—great for casual parties or daytime events.
